Understanding Bankroll Management

Bankroll management refers to the process of setting aside a specific amount of money for gaming activities and sticking to it. This approach helps players avoid overspending and minimize financial risks associated with casino games. A well-managed bankroll can also improve decision-making skills, allowing players to make more informed choices about which games to play and when to stop.

Setting a Realistic Bankroll

Before you start playing, it’s essential to set a realistic bankroll that suits your budget and gaming goals. Here are some factors to consider:

  • Initial Deposit : Determine how much money you can afford to lose in the short term.
  • Game Choice : Consider the minimum and maximum bet limits for each game to ensure they fit within your budget.
  • Session Length : Plan for a specific session length, taking into account the time it takes to complete games or rounds.

Managing Emotional Bets

Emotional betting is a common mistake that can deplete your bankroll quickly. To avoid this, follow these tips:

  • Avoid Impulsive Decisions : Take time to think before making decisions.
  • Don’t Chase Losses : Avoid increasing bets after losing to recoup losses.
  • Don’t Get Emotional About Wins : Manage emotions and don’t get carried away with excitement.

Monitoring Your Bankroll

Regularly monitoring your bankroll is essential for maintaining a healthy balance between gaming and financial responsibilities. Here are some tips:

  • Track Winnings and Losses : Keep a record of your wins and losses to identify areas for improvement.
  • Set Realistic Goals : Set achievable goals, such as winning a certain amount within a specific timeframe.
  • Adjust Your Strategy : Adapt your strategy based on performance data.
